Highest Hit seems to be around 1400. He is slowable easily with Malos. Use Turgur's (51 slow). He has a lot of HP and he seems to have very high AC since none of my hits were landing for much damage. He casts Wizard spells as he is a Wizard. He mainly chain cast Immobilize on the Cleric and Shaman, which made his DPS a lot less than it would be otherwise. His AE isn't a problem since he doesn't use it much. We pushed him into a corner by the orb he's standing by, and had the Shaman and Cleric shrunk standing by the orb. It shielded against the AE, but the little wall they hid behind isn't big enough for more than 2 or 3 people, really, but we stuck them there and they were fine. Wizard. Can be mindwracked. Been tanked by bards. AC causes him to take 65% more damage than Thall Va Kelun. 127 melee DPS slowed. Casts wizard spells. Can AE black winds. Due to this, fight should take 52% as long as Thal Va Kelun, the mob I'm comparing this to here. Name means something like 'Master of the Knowledge'.
